Prime minister Dr. Manmohan Singh inaugurated the nation's first all-women bank – the

Bharatiya Mahila Bank (BMB)- in Mumbai on Tuesday in the presence of Congress president

and UPA Chairperson Sonia Gandhi, on the birth anniversary of former Prime Minister Indira

Gandhi. Sonia Gandhi said that this was an appropriate tribute to the memory of Indira Gandhi

on her birth anniversary. The Congress President also distributed the bank-kits to the first five

account holders of the new bank

Today we observe the birth anniversary of Indira Gandhi. There have been many events to

commemorate today but nothing would be more appropriate tribute to her life and work than the

inauguration of the Bharatiya Mahila Bank which aims to provide financial services to the

women in general and women Self Help Group (SHG) in particular.

All though her life Indira Gandhi was guided by a passionate commitment to her country and the

people and was fearless in defending their interest. She was dedicated to the secular, egalitarian

and democratic values which guided her as an individual and remained the back-throb of her

governance and policy. She had a deep concern for the weaker, the poor, the minorities and was

acutely sensitive to women issues. The empowerment of women was an important goal that she

set for herself and for her government. Her own life was a testimony on what could be achieved

by women empowerment and I am very happy that the motto of the new bank is ‘empowering

women, empowering India”.

I hope that this bank will emerge as a catalyst for ensuring greater gender justice and equality. I

think it is laudable that the bank has cleared a women-run business; predominantly, employ

women and address gender related aspects of empowerment and financial inclusiveness. Of

course, it is entirely appropriate that its chairperson is a women as well as being a distinguished

banker and as Chidambaram ji had said, the bank will have all-women-director board.

Of course, there are much works to be done. I understand that only a small proportion of loan

comes in public sector bank in the names of women and the credits extended to them is roughly

7.3% of the total. Although as many as five public sector banks are there, only one fifth of the

bank employees are women. Surely there are social and cultural barriers that prevent women

from greater access to banking services, as well as a fair share of employment.

It is true that there are some barriers have been removed; for instance Self Help movement is one

that has seen commendable success in recent years, especially for women and I might add with

an impeccable record of repayment.

At the end of March, 2015, there were nearly sixty lac of them and the total credit extended to

them was nearly Rs. 33000 crore. There is regional imbalance too with Andhra Pradesh almost

half of this funding. As more and more women SHGs take route in other states and it is rapidly

taking place in number of other states including Jammu and Kashmir, banks will naturally be

called upon to increase their presence there. In this context one thing, I will have to say..

I believe that the use of Aadhar has the potential to revolutionalise the relationship of the vast

majority of our people with the financial system through the delivery of subsidy welfare and cash

payment. Through Direct Benefit Transfer (DBT) Aadhar will eliminate the middlemen and

reduce corruption on a large scale. But for this to happen, the banks will have to come on board

quickly. I hope the Bharatiya Mahila Bank will rise through this challenge as well.
